MOTIVATION
This Project biometric employee attendance service is an easy to use attendance clock. The system avails the gathering of work hours by a small finger print scanner attached to the computer. Employees will punch IN and punch OUT by using their fingerprints, utilizing any computer connected to the intranet. It will become possible to gather accurate time attendance of your employees in real time.

INTRODUCTION OF BIOMETRICS
Biometrics: A New Era in Security Traditionally, authorized users have gained access to secure information systems, buildings, or equipment via multiple passwords, personal identification numbers, secure tokens, keys, codes, identification cards, and so on. However, these security methods have important weaknesses they can be lost,
stolen, forged, or forgotten. Biometric technology would change security and access control by providing systems that recognize us by our biological or behavioral characteristics, such as fingerprints, iris patterns, facial characteristics, and speech patterns.

TYPES OF BIOMETRICS
Fingerprint scans Fingerprint-scanning systems use optical or capacitative electronic sensors to capture samples of fingerprints. They then conduct vector or minutia analysis of the samples and classify them based on their distinctive pattern of ridges, loops, whorls, and arches. Voice authentication Voice-authentication systems typically use a sound card or a DSP to digitize voice input. The systems then use a matrix to classify the data based on voice characteristics. Eye scans Biometric devices are sometimes used to scan a person s retina or iris.
